    Dive into the Essentials of Wave Trend Oscillator Trading

    At its core, the Wave Trend Oscillator is a technical indicator, adept at highlighting overbought and oversold conditions in financial markets. It works by gauging the cyclical movement of market prices, plotting the ebb and flow similar to waves. Traders favor this indicator for its simplicity and effectiveness, often using it to anticipate potential reversals and harnessing these insights to optimize entry and exit points.

    Understanding the Mechanics:

    The oscillator is presented as two lines flowing on a chart: the main Wave Trend line and the trigger line, known as the signal line. Their interaction is pivotal, as crossovers between these lines offer valuable trading signals. A market is considered overbought when the Wave Trend line ascends above the upper extreme threshold, while the opposite indicates an oversold market.

    Practical Application:

    Traders typically apply the Wave Trend Oscillator on various time frames, aligning it with their individual trading styles. Day traders might use shorter time frames such as 5-minute or 15-minute charts, while swing traders might opt for hourly or 4-hour charts to gauge the broader market trend.

    Strategies for Trending and Ranging Markets:

    In a trending market, the Wave Trend Oscillator assists traders in riding the trend by providing entry points after minor pullbacks. Conversely, in a range-bound market, it signals entry points for reversals at the range’s support or resistance levels.

    Key Tips for Enhanced Trading:

    1. Combine with Other Indicators: Pair the Wave Trend Oscillator with other technical tools like moving averages or RSI for stronger confirmation.
    2. Watch for Divergences: Divergences occur when price and the oscillator move in opposite directions, indicating potential trend shifts.
    3. Pay Attention to Thresholds: Recognize the significance of the extreme thresholds, as they offer crucial insight into market conditions.

    Frequently Asked Questions:
    Q: What is the Wave Trend Oscillator (WTO) Trading?
    A: Wave Trend Oscillator is a technical indicator used in trading stocks, forex, and other financial instruments. It helps traders identify potential trend reversals, overbought or oversold conditions, and entry/exit points.

    Q: How does the Wave Trend Oscillator work?
    A: The WTO combines multiple moving averages to generate signals. It calculates the distance between two moving averages and plots it as a histogram. The oscillator’s color changes based on the direction and strength of the trend, allowing traders to spot potential opportunities.

    Q: What are the key components of the Wave Trend Oscillator?
    A: The main components of the WTO are the two moving averages, lengths of which can be adjusted according to trader preferences. Additionally, the oscillator has a trigger level and various colors that represent different market conditions.

    Q: How can traders use the Wave Trend Oscillator in their trading strategy?
    A: Traders can use the WTO to identify potential trend reversals by looking for color change in the oscillator. A shift from positive to negative or vice versa can indicate a change in market sentiment. Additionally, traders can use overbought or oversold readings to identify possible price corrections.
